After attending a hard hat tour of the new and improved south side of Dolores Park, we were all excited for the grand opening that was set to happen a week ago. Worried about rain, city officials cancelled the event. Now there's word that the party is back on for next Wednesday. And, once again, the San Francisco Recreation & Parks Department is asking visitors to bring their glow and take home their trash.
According to an event Facebook page, the theme of the party is "Light Up Dolores." Makes sense, as the festivities get going at 4 p.m. and last until 7 p.m. Organizers at the Parks Department ask attendees to bring/wear glowing and light-up equipment and accessories.
On the tour, city officials made it clear that they were sensitive to the problems of litter and graffiti in what can feel like SF's most popular gathering spot. Those sentiments are reflected in the invitation. The event's Facebook page cautions: "This is a LEAVE NO TRACE event. Pack it in and pack it out."
Despite the fact there's some serious rain predicted for Friday and Saturday, it looks like Wednesday will be partly sunny and warm.
